HR Coordinator

HR Coordinator | Birmingham City Centre | 6 months FTC - Immediate Start | £27K to £30K plus benefits

Are you an organised HR professional with a keen eye for detail and a passion for delivering an exceptional employee experience? Our client is looking for an HR Administrator to join their busy HR team on an initial 6-month fixed-term contract, with an immediate start available. This is a fantastic opportunity to join a supportive and collaborative HR function where you'll play a key role in ensuring the smooth running of day-to-day HR operations while supporting a variety of exciting people projects. This is a full-time role that requires an office presence of 4 days on-site and 1 day a week working from home.

The Role

As HR Administrator, you'll provide essential support across the full employee lifecycle, ensuring HR processes are delivered accurately and efficiently. Your responsibilities will include:

  • Creating and maintaining employee contracts, offer letters, amendments, and other HR documentation.
  • Managing onboarding and offboarding processes, ensuring a seamless experience for employees.
  • Maintaining accurate employee records and HR data, with responsibility for updating and managing information within the HR system.
  • Supporting the maintenance of HR policies, procedures, and standard operating procedures for quality management purposes.
  • Producing and maintaining HR reports and KPIs to support business decision-making.
  • Assisting with a range of HR projects, including annual benchmarking exercises, data analysis, and annual salary review communications.
  • Providing general HR administrative support to the wider HR team as required.

About You

We're looking for someone who is highly organised, proactive, and enjoys working in a fast-paced environment. You'll have previous HR administration experience and be confident managing sensitive information with accuracy and discretion.

Ideally, you'll also have:

  • Experience in an HR-related role, ideally from within a fast-paced, dynamic, and evolving environment.
  • Strong administrative and organisational skills with excellent attention to detail.
  • Good Excel and data management skills.
  • Ideally, a degree or similar experience.
  • The ability to manage multiple priorities and meet deadlines.
  • A positive, team-oriented approach with excellent communication skills.
